Lady Aces' Rally Falls Short As Robinson Prevails

From Comments by Assistant Coach Bonnie Keepes.:

The MCHS Volleyball team faced Robinson, LIC conference competitors Thursday September 14. The Aces previously beat the Maroons in tournament play, but fell short on their home court.

The Maroons took the first set 25-15, the girls just weren’t on their attacking game. With a high hitting error rate, combined with aggressive marroon play the set was lopsided. The second set the Aces rallied and tightened up the hitting errors, but fell 25-23.

Some highlights were the libero Grace Thacker with 15 digs, Kathryn Blake 9 kills, 8 digs, Sarah McCorkle 18 assists, Piper Belt 2 kills, 5 digs, Maycee Randall 3 kills, Madison Stevens 2 kills, 3 digs, Nora Jones 2 kills, 4 digs, Marissa Goldman and Chandler Cusick 1 dig each.

The JV team took Robinson in 2 sets 25-19, 25-18. They had a slow 0-8 start the first set, but came from behind. They started attacking often and sent over very few free balls to help secure the win. Some highlights were Lyla Keepes 2 Aces, 3 digs, 10 kills, Jayla Johnson 3 Aces, 10 digs, 2 kills, Mattie Armstrong 20 assists, 1 kill, Madellyn Bingham 5 kills, Kyleigh Smith 4 Kills, 1 assist, Mercedes Dillard 7 digs, 1 assist, Kyla Militoni 5 digs, Gabi Peach, 3 digs, 2 kills, Tenley Davis 2 digs.

The Fresh/Soph team won both sets 25-20, 25-17.

Numbers Back Up Lady Aces' Dominance

Coach Karin Kelsey provided us some interesting facts about Lady Aces Golf that illustrates their level of dominance this decade!

The win this week against Fairfield marked our 197  consecutive win. 

Our senior Maria Kennard was on the team that lost to Effingham St. Anthony on September 23, 2020. It was a triangular match at Olney and they had a great player, Macy Ludwig who  shot a 3 under par that day! After that loss we went on to win our Regional and Salem’s Sectional! 

Emily Gottman, Miley Kennard, Zeme Moore, Ava Brumagin and Elyse Swanson have not lost a match in their high school golf career! 

The consecutive wins are:

After September 23, 2020-

2020- 19-0

2021- 78-0

2022 - 69-0

2023 - 31-0

In 2020 we lost two matches the St. Anthony match and also earlier in 2020 we lost to Massac County by 2 strokes at their Patriot Invite. Our record for 2020 was 40-2. (Covid year, no state tournament)

Jr. Lady Aces Bang Out 10 Hits To Beat New Hope

Mt. Carmel Jr. Lady Aces were victorious against New Hope 8-4 on Monday. Mt. Carmel Jr. Lady Aces were the first to get on the board in the first when Gracee Haggard singled, scoring one run. A single by Josie Crews gave New Hope the lead, 2-1, in the bottom of the second. Mt. Carmel Jr. Lady Aces took the lead in the top of the fourth inning after Harper Warnken walked, and Annelise Garrison singled, each scoring one run. New Hope took the lead in the bottom of the fourth. Josie Crews singled, scoring two runs, to give New Hope the advantage, 4-3. Journey Loudermilk doubled, which helped Mt. Carmel Jr. Lady Aces tie the game at four in the top of the fifth. Mt. Carmel Jr. Lady Aces captured the lead, 8-4, in the top of the seventh when Quincy Keepes singled, scoring two runs, Journey Loudermilk doubled, scoring one run, and Harper Warnken singled, scoring one run. 

 Harper started in the circle for Mt. Carmel Jr. Lady Aces. The starting pitcher allowed five hits and four runs over four innings, striking out six and walking three. Kirsten Vaughn started the game for New Hope. They gave up 10 hits and eight runs (five earned) over seven innings, striking out seven and walking two. Quincy Keepes threw three innings of no-run ball for Mt. Carmel Jr. Lady Aces in relief. They surrendered two hits, striking out three and walking one. 

 Mt. Carmel Jr. Lady Aces amassed 10 hits in the game. Gracee Haggard led Mt. Carmel Jr. Lady Aces with three hits in four at bats. Quincy Keepes and Journey Loudermilk were tough to handle back-to-back in the lineup, as each drove in two runs for Mt. Carmel Jr. Lady Aces. Malarie Simpson and Josie Crews each collected two hits for New Hope.

Lady Aces Finish 2nd At Olney Tourney

From Bonnie Keepes: The Lady Aces took 2nd out of 12 teams in the Olney tournament Saturday. 

The Lady Aces won their pool beating South Central in three sets 25-21, 20-25,15-8.

Next, facing Carterville, we won 25-18, 15-25, 15-11. This sent the team to the gold bracket.


In the first gold bracket matchup we played Mt. Zion first winning 26-24, 26-18.

Then dropped a match against a tough Fairfield team 13-25, 22-25.  

After Fairfield we played the host team Olney to take second winning 28-26, 25-21. 


Standouts were Sarah McCorkle making the all tournament team averaging 18 assists per match, Kathryn Blake averaging 7 kills per match, Piper Belt with an average of 3 kills per match, Madison Stevens 8 kills per match, and Maycee Randall 4 kills per match. 

We had great passing and defense from our libero Grace Thacker and Defensive specialist Marissa Goldman.

Jr Lady Aces Softball wins the 2023 Futures softball tournament in Fairfield!

This is the third year in a row the Jr Lady Aces have brought home the title. The first game they faced New Hope in what was the closest game of the day. The Lady Aces won 3-1. Gracee Haggard lead the lady aces at the plate going 2-2 with two runs scored. Haleigh Prosise was in the circle for the Lady Aces and threw all 7 innings. She had 3 walks, 5 strike outs and one hit against her. Bella Hodges led New Hope at the plate with the lone hit of the game. 

The second game of the day the Lady Aces faced Richland Co. Middle School winning 7-3. Many of the Aces came away with multiple hits. Alivia Peach went 2-4, Quincy Keepes went 2-3, Farryn King went 1-3, Annalise Garrison went 2-3, and Harper Warnken went 1-3. Annalise Garrison lead the team with 3 RBI’s. Harper Warnken started in the circle going 5 innings. Warnken had 3 walks, 3 strike outs, and had six hits against her. Quincy Keepes came in to finish the game with one walk and two strikeouts. 

The championship game came down to Mt Carmel versus Albion Grade School. Mt Carmel took the title with a 9-1 win. Alivia Peach led the Jr Aces in hits going 2-3 at the plate. Haleigh Prosise threw all 4 innings, giving up 2 walks, 3 strikeouts, and had three hits against her. Holly Hensley and Fallon Richard’s led Albion Grade School both going 1-2 at the plate.
